HC Deb 25 March 1974 vol 871 c46W
Mr. Pardoe

asked the Chancellor of the Exchequer if he will publish a table in the OFFICIAL REPORT showing the revenue derived in the last financial year at current tax rates, at the tax rates fixed in April 1970 adjusted for the decline in the value of money, and the percentage increase or decrease, from income tax, surtax, corporation tax, capital gains tax, death duties, oil duties, tobacco duties, spirits duties, beer and wine duties, betting and gaming tax, car tax, and total tax revenue.

Dr. Gilbert

The receipts of the vari-outs taxes in 1972–73 are contained in Financial Statistics; provisional out-turn figures for receipts in 1973–74 will be published in the Financial Statement and Budget Report tomorrow. It is not clear what is meant by the second part of the Question with reference to the direct taxes: if the hon. Member will write to me setting out in more detail the information he would like I shall try to provide it.
